>DPPt was supposed to have the Azure Flute, an event where you simply obtained the thing, were given the implication to go to Spear Pillar, go there, move up one tile and say yes to a prompt to play it to encounter and capture Arceus
>scrapped for being too confusing

>ORAS has Regigigas, who can only be fought at Daytime a day after capturing the last Regi with all three Regis in the party, and Regice must be nicknamed and be holding an Ice-related item and the only indication of what to do is a random NPC in Pacifidlog, the Literally Who Town of the game
>not to mention the other legendaries who require things like a Level 100 Pokemon, three Pokemon with all of their EV Points Spent, three Pokemon with max happiness, being on a random Mirage Island or carrying around fucking Castform with no indication whatsoever regarding anything, and then you need the version exclusive legends to get the third version's so good fucking luck trying to get such an endeavor to happen in the abyss known as GTS
>this is somehow acceptable

Look, it's not that I enjoy removing content. But what I'm saying is that these puzzles are really not worth being mad about. If Pokemon caves were big, Zelda-like dungeons with puzzles that affect the whole thing and build up to something, then yes, that would be awesome. But that's never been the case. Things like the ice sliding puzzle in the OP are just disjointed wastes of time that are haphazardly thrown in to stall you. Hell, look at the puzzle in the OP again. It looks complicated when you just look at all the turns you have to take. But if you really look at it, you'll notice that the first few steps are actually unnecessary because you'll end up in the top right corner no matter what you do. And from there, the rest of the way consists of choosing between two directions (since a rock is always blocking one and another is the way you came from) and the solution is obvious. Not exactly a brain twister, is it? And that's one of the more complex puzzles. Most of them were just pushing rocks with Strength along the only possible path. Or the same 3 rocks lined up where you push the two to the sides first and then the middle one. You know the one. Is something as pointless as this really, really worth being nostalgic about?
